Question
State whether true or false. If false, correct the statement.
In a step down transformer the number of turns in primary coil is greater than that of the number of turns in the secondary coil.
Options
True
False
Advertisements
Solution
In a step down transformer the number of turns in primary coil is greater than that of the number of turns in the secondary coil- True
